Amanda has been involved with horses all her life and has EXTENSIVE training, turnout and showing experience, including breaking, showing in hand (all breeds), dressage, hacking, western and harness - the list goes on and on. She has competed at Sydney, Canberra, Brisbane, Melbourne and Hobart Royal Shows. Amanda has worked at "El Caballo" where she rode High School trained stallions and also gained experience in training horses in long reins (including high school movements such as piaffe/passage/levade) and trick training. She also has exerience as a Stud Manager. In 1994 she passed her EFA NCAS Level 1 (general) qualification.Recent achievements include 2003 Tasmanian Show Horse Council Reserve Newcommer Galloway of the Year riding Melinda Hill's El Sharanah Chantelle. Amanda rode Jindara Karana to Supreme Ridden Dilute and Champion Hack at the 2004 UPWBDA Twilight Show in Hobart. She was also Supreme Ridden Exhibit at the 2004 Tasmanian UPWBDA State Championships. On the same weekend Jindara Kalypso was State Champion Non Palomino Progeny. Amanda is available for lessons and show preparation/exhibiting in and around the Hobart area.
